I just took a few minutes to smooth my baby hair down with some gel and a scarf, and the first style that we're going to do is very simple, because i don't know about you, but when i get braids or protective style, i really just want to Break from my hair, so it's just going to be a nice high bun. I took out some bangs in the front and then i'm just going to twist all of my hair and wrap it into kind of like a big ninja bun on the top of my head now, every single time you do this, it's going to look a little Bit different, so you can honestly like play with it until it looks how you want it to look. I'M gon na, pin it with one bobby pin and then take a hair tie and kind of make sure it gets held into place and here's. The final look. Next up, we have a grown and sexy half up, half down. Look all you're going to want to do is split your hair in half make sure that you pull out some tendrils so that the style looks a little bit softer and then wrap your hair tie about two or three times around the top ponytail and boom grown And sexy, but still cool, you know still trendy, still swaggy and then, if you want to take this a step farther, you can actually wrap some of your braids around the hair tie. So it has a lifted look and to me this gives me like eye dream of genie vibes, so i'm just going to take probably about 10 to 15 braids from the back of the ponytail, i'm going to wrap that around the ponytail as many times as i Need to and then pin the excess in the back and there you go. Next up we have the space buns vibes, i'm going to take the hair, that's been parted in half from the front and part it in half again down the middle, pull out some tendrils in the front and the sides and put my hair into pigtails, and you Could wear your hair like this? You know, that's your vibe! I mean what's wrong with that. Nothing at all, but then i'm going to just twist my hair two strand twist the pigtail and then wrap the pigtail around the ponytail base, making sure that you wrap from the front so that you get a really nice looking bun and again. This is going to look different every single time. You do it so no worries if it's not completely. Even all of these styles are very relaxed and, like just chill so don't feel like they need to be perfect and i'm just going to repeat that process on the opposite side bobby pinning into place and here's the final look. You know i'm on the road in my rv or caravan again, taking the hair splitting it in half from the front to the back and putting all the hair at the front of your head, as you put a ponytail right at the top of your forehead, because We really want this bun to be front and center, then i'm just going to wrap it around itself before twisting, and this gives the bun a smaller appearance. So it's not as big as the first bun and again just wrap it around i'm really playing with buns and ponytails for these styles, because the braids kind of make everything look extra special and complicated. So you don't have to do too much on the styling end. Then i'm going to pin my bun into place, but i'm also leaving out some tendrils from the bun so that the style looks a little bit like boho chic whimsical like i don't care about anything, but i'm still hot as hell and then next up. We have more of a polished look, so this is going to be kind of like a goddess braid in the front and i'm going to pin it in the back. So i'm just going to make a cornrow headband at the very front of my hair and with this every single time you cross some hair over to make the braid. You just want to pick up about two to four braids so that it's actually attached to your head, if you're someone who doesn't know how to cornrow this might be a really good way to practice and don't be discouraged. If it takes you a few times, it honestly took me six months to learn how to cornrow so be gentle with yourself and once i get done, cornrowing, i'm just going to braid the hair all the way down to the end, secure that with a rubber band And then i'm going to situate the braid to the back of my head in a way that looks flattering and then bobby pin it into place now the braids are pretty heavy. So if you have like a mini clamp that would probably work better so that you know it's going to be secure all day and then, if you want to have a twofer with this style, you can actually unattach it from your head and just let it hang And it gives you those you know that boho energy, so the next style is one of my favorites as well, and it is a fishtail style. But this is a little bit different because you're not fish tailing everything. I'M going to leave some hair out in the back, not enough for like a half up half down situation, but just enough so that there's something happening in the back as well as pull some tendrils from the front and the sides now you're going to split your Hair into two sections take some hair from the outside section and bring it over to the inside of the second section, and that's how you create a fishtail. It'S more so like basket weaving and not necessarily like braiding, because you really just want to create a pattern on top of the hair and i'm going to complete this pattern. All the way down the length of my braids and then i'm going to secure that with a rubber band and then i'm just going to fluff the hair out. So it looks a little bit more messy and full, and that is the final look now.
